U.S. Evidence Against Mexican Ex-Defense Minister Raises Conviction Doubts

The case that Gen. Salvador Cienfuegos took bribes from drug cartels is largely circumstantial, people familiar with the matter say, clouding chances of a conviction in Mexico.
